7. PHONEBOOK
Your phone can store up to 100 phonebook entries with names and numbers. Each phonebook entry can have
amaximumof24digitsforthephonenumberand12charactersforthename.Youcanalsoselectdierent
ringtones for your phonebook entries. Phonebook entries are stored in alphabetically by name.
